Detailed Engineering Specifications

Designed for demanding industrial environments, this Viton O-ring boasts an Inside Diameter of 7.694 inches, an Outside Diameter of 10.458 inches, and a 0.111-inch cross-section. Constructed from premium Viton (FKM), it exhibits outstanding resistance to high temperatures (up to 400°F/200°C), a wide range of chemicals, fuels, and oils. Its low compression set ensures long-term sealing integrity under pressure. This o-ring is ideal for applications in chemical processing, automotive, aerospace, and oil & gas industries where reliability is paramount.

Installation Procedure

1. Ensure the mating groove is clean, dry, and free of burrs or damage. 2. Lightly lubricate the O-ring and groove with a compatible lubricant if recommended for the application. 3. Carefully install the O-ring into the groove, avoiding stretching or twisting, to achieve a flush fit.

⚠️ Engineering Warnings

  • Verify chemical compatibility for specific operating fluids.
  • Avoid exposure to steam, hot water, or certain amines as Viton may degrade under these conditions.
